How Long Does CBD Cream Take to Work?
CBD cream typically begins working within 15 to 45 minutes of application. Onset time varies by skin thickness at the application site, how much cream is used, and whether the area is warm or cold at the time of application.
Topical cannabinoids work by absorbing through the skin and interacting with receptors in local tissue rather than entering the bloodstream. Thinner skin areas like the back of the knee or inner wrist absorb faster than thick-skinned areas like the heel or palm. Applying to warm skin after a shower speeds absorption. Cold skin slows it. Using a generous amount and massaging in fully produces faster, more consistent results than a thin layer applied and left.
For chronic pain, do not judge effectiveness from a single application. Topical cannabinoids build up in local tissue with consistent use, and many customers report that effects improve noticeably after 3 to 5 days of twice-daily application compared to the first use. Reapply every 4 to 6 hours for ongoing pain management.
